Spills And Stains April 2, 2024 - Comments Off on Spills And Stains Spills And Stains Spills And Stains ← Previous Next → 25+ Mostly Embarrassing Royal Wardrobe Malfunction 25+ Mostly Embarrassing Royal Wardrobe Malfunction